A reusable client workflow

1

Keep the untouched original

Preserve the client export before any cleanup, rebuild, or bulk pricing work.

2

Compare the edited file

Surface removed rows, dropped columns, changed identifiers, zeroed prices, category changes, and other risky edits.

3

Review ambiguous changes

Leave business decisions such as missing categories, industries, identifiers, or prices to a human.

4

Run the final preflight

Validate supported file and row-level issues, apply deterministic repairs, and prepare the corrected output.

High-risk examples

  • Price or cost changed to blank or zero.
  • A uuid or other identifier was lost or changed.
  • A column disappeared between versions.
  • Industry, category, or subcategory changed unexpectedly.
  • Rows were removed or a suspicious mass change occurred.

What the tool refuses to guess

  • A missing business category or industry.
  • A missing item name, identifier, or intended price.
  • Which conflicting duplicate represents the client's intended service.
  • Whether a commercially unusual price change was intentional.

Privacy for client files

The scan, comparison, and findings preview process price-book rows in the browser. The client does not need to connect a Housecall Pro account or share an API key with ImportFix. Standard website, analytics, and checkout requests can still occur; the price-book rows are not sent to an ImportFix analysis server for the comparison.
